    TIT (today i teach): you can use https://www.urbandictionary.com/ to explain new words of phrases.
    in firefox (and many other browsers too), you can right click the search bar and “add search engine”, and you can add a “keyword”, i personally use “ud”, and then i can type “ud dni” (for instance) in the address bar (ctrl+l to get there quick) and it goes straight to results

    if the page isn’t supported, it doesn’t show “add search engine”, google translate for example, you can still add it in a different way
    search for a recognisable word, and bookmark the resulting page. then go to bookmark/manage bookmarks (ctrl+shift+o), find the bookmark, replace your recognisable word with “%s”, add a keyword (depending on the language i use 2en, 2de, 2jp etc)
